Escondido Street Faire
This is one of the biggest street fairs in California. It occurs twice per year, in the spring and fall. Downtown Escondido is packed with more than 500 vendors. You can find unique handicrafts, crafts, and clothes. Dozens of food booths sell delectable delicacies. Live entertainment takes place on numerous stages. A separate children’s zone includes rides and games. It’s a large and entertaining community gathering.

Grape Day Festival
This event celebrates Escondido’s historical roots. The city was once a major grape-growing region. The festival is held at Grape Day Park and the History Center. It includes historical reenactments and pioneer demonstrations. You can press your own grapes and tour historic buildings. It is a fun, educational look into the city’s past.

Farmers Market
The Escondido Farmers Market is a weekly event. It occurs every Tuesday on Grand Avenue. Local farmers sell fresh, seasonally appropriate fruits and vegetables. Vendors sell handmade bread, flowers, and honey. Ready-to-eat meals are offered. It’s an excellent place to buy for healthful, locally sourced food.
